## Step 1The question is asking which process occurs inside of mitochondria. Mitochondria are often referred to as the 'powerhouse' of the cell. They are the sites of cellular respiration, a process that ultimately generates fuel for the cell's activities.## Step 2On the other hand, photosynthesis is a process by which green plants and some other organisms use sunlight to synthesize food. Essentially, photosynthesis happens in the chloroplast, which is the chlorophyll-containing plastid, not in mitochondria.
